The UNESCO World Heritage shrine at Bodh Gaya marking the exact spot where Prince Siddhartha attained enlightenment beneath the Bodhi Tree to become the Buddha. It is the holiest site in Buddhism.

Best Time to Visit
October to March for pleasant weather; Buddha Purnima (April–May) is the most significant festival.
Bodh Gaya is the most sacred of the four principal pilgrimage sites of Buddhism, being the place of the Buddha's enlightenment. Pilgrims and monks from across the world gather here to meditate under the Bodhi Tree in the footsteps of the Awakened One. The temple embodies the birth of a spiritual tradition that spread across Asia. As a UNESCO World Heritage Site, it is treasured as a landmark of human spiritual history.
The towering Mahabodhi temple, its pyramidal spire rising about 55 metres, stands beside the sacred Bodhi Tree — a direct descendant of the very tree under which the Buddha gained enlightenment. Beneath the tree lies the Vajrasana (Diamond Throne), a sandstone slab marking the seat of awakening. The complex, with its ancient railings, votive stupas and meditating pilgrims from every Buddhist nation, hums with a profound sense of peace. Originally established by Ashoka and rebuilt over the centuries, it is one of the earliest brick temples still standing in India.
